Analysis of the characteristics of metal laser cutting machine:
1.Laser cutting machine is a high -energy, good density controller without contact processing
After the laser beam is focused, it forms a very small effect point with a very strong energy, which can achieve a small straight cut seam; the smallest edge heat -influencing area, a small local deformation; no contact with cutting and cutting processing The knife is worn; any hardness material can be cut. Laser beam is strong and highly adaptable and flexible, which is easy to achieve automated cutting.
2.The laser cutting machine is narrow, and the workpiece deformation is small
The laser beam focuses on a small light spot, so that the focus can reach a high power density. The beams and materials are relative to linearly, making the cave continuously forming a narrow seam with a narrow width. The heating edge is very small, and there is basically no workpiece deformation. Laser cutting machines have no burrs, wrinkles, high accuracy, better than plasma cutting.
